A bill to establish a national program for scientific research, development, and demonstration in energy and energy related technologies and for the coordination and financial supplementation of Federal energy research and development; to establish a research corporation to demonstrate certain energy technologies; to amend the National Science Foundation to fund basic and applied research related to energy, and for other purposes.
National Energy Research and Development Policy Act - Title I: Declares it to be the policy of the Congress to establish a national program of scientific research and applied technology adequate to meet enumerated objectives, including: (1) to develop the technology base necessary to support development of options for future energy policy decisions; (2) to formulate policies for the conservation of present energy resources; and (3) to promote research and development of adequate energy systems to support essential needs.
Establishes an Energy Research Management Project to be composed of specified officials, including the Director of the National Science Foundation, who shall serve as Chairman. Provides that the Management Project shall have an Administrator who shall also serve as the Staff Director.
Directs the Management Project to: (1) formulate a comprehensive energy research and development strategy for the Federal Government; (2) utilize the funds authorized by this Act to advance the energy research and development strategy through specified means; (3) identify opportunities to accelerate the commercial application of new energy technologies; and (4) establish procedures for periodic consultation with representatives of science, industry, and environmental organizations, who have special expertise in the areas of energy research. Prescribes the priorities which the Management Project shall follow in evaluating and undertaking research.
Provides that where a participant in an energy research and development project holds background patents, trade secrets, or proprietary information which will be employed in and are requisite to the proposed research and development project, the Management Project shall enter into an agreement which will provide equitable protection to the participants' rights.
Authorizes the Director of the National Science Foundation to fund basic and applied research related to energy in support of the objectives of this Act. Directs the Administrator to keep the Congress fully and currently informed of all of the Management Project's activities and submit to the Congress an annual report.
Authorizes to be appropriated $10,000,000 annually for the administrative expenses of the Management Project. Authorizes to be appropriated not to exceed $800,000,000 for fiscal year 1974, and, subject to annual congressional authorizations, $800,000,000 for each of the four following fiscal years to carry out the provisions of this Act relating to the advancement of energy research and development.
Title II: Declares that it is the policy of the Federal Government to bring the resources of technology to commercial development by establishing a Government-industry corporation jointly managed and funded to work in conjunction with the Energy Research Management Project created by title I of this Act.
Establishes the Energy Research Management Project Corporation. Provides for a Board of Directors and President of such Corporation. Makes it the function of the Corporation, on the basis of the research programs established by the Energy Research Management Project, to construct demonstration-type facilities in order to determine the environmental, economical, and technical feasibility thereof.
States that energy produced by such commercial facilities shall be disposed of in such manner and under such terms and conditions as the Corporation shall prescribe. Authorizes to be appropriated to the Corporation, for fiscal year 1974, $6,000,000, and for each of the next nine succeeding fiscal years such sums as may be necessary.
